<?php
/* * This file is part of the Symfony package. * * (c) Fabien Potencier <fabien@symfony.com> * * For the full copyright and license information, please view the LICENSE * file that was distributed with this source code. */
namespace Symfony\Component\Routing;
use Symfony\Component\Routing\Exception\InvalidArgumentException;
class Alias { private $id; private $deprecation = [];
public function __construct(string $id) { $this->id = $id; }
/** * @return static */ public function withId(string $id): self { $new = clone $this;
$new->id = $id;
return $new; }
/** * Returns the target name of this alias. * * @return string The target name */ public function getId(): string { return $this->id; }
/** * Whether this alias is deprecated, that means it should not be referenced anymore. * * @param string $package The name of the composer package that is triggering the deprecation * @param string $version The version of the package that introduced the deprecation * @param string $message The deprecation message to use * * @return $this * * @throws InvalidArgumentException when the message template is invalid */ public function setDeprecated(string $package, string $version, string $message): self { if ('' !== $message) { if (preg_match('#[\r\n]|\*/#', $message)) { throw new InvalidArgumentException('Invalid characters found in deprecation template.'); }
if (!str_contains($message, '%alias_id%')) { throw new InvalidArgumentException('The deprecation template must contain the "%alias_id%" placeholder.'); } }
$this->deprecation = [ 'package' => $package, 'version' => $version, 'message' => $message ?: 'The "%alias_id%" route alias is deprecated. You should stop using it, as it will be removed in the future.', ];
return $this; }
public function isDeprecated(): bool { return (bool) $this->deprecation; }
/** * @param string $name Route name relying on this alias */ public function getDeprecation(string $name): array { return [ 'package' => $this->deprecation['package'], 'version' => $this->deprecation['version'], 'message' => str_replace('%alias_id%', $name, $this->deprecation['message']), ]; } }
